April 9th 2010

What a beautiful day to be on the water in the Strait of Georgia. We left Horseshoe Bay at 1130am and headed out of Howe Sound to the South end of Bowen island. We got our gear down around noon 4 miles of Roger Curtis. We trolled around for an hour or so and didn’t see much. There was no wind and the Stait of Georgia was flat calm Stait of Georgia  we headed over to Gabriolla Island. On the way over we saw Dolphin to make the ride more enjoyable. We got out gear down at 3pm at the Grande we then saw a big bunch of birds and 8 to 10 bald eagles Bald eagles feeding on Herring  feeding on a school of big herring that was on the surface. We started to show feed on the bottom as we were nearing Whale bone Bay. We then started to get quite abit of action Fishing Action Shot  with bottom fish we ended the day with 9 rock cod Picture of Customer with Rock Cod  , 2 flounder, 1 lingcod, 5 pacific cod, and we did get a nice Spring salmon Spring Salmon . It was a great day on the water with plenty off fish probably would of done better for salmon but there were just to many bottom fish. We stopped fishing at 7pm to get back before dark Sun set after a great day fishing . On the way back we saw the Dolphin in the middle of the straight again. The crab traps Customer with Fresh Crab   did well with a good number of large Dundeness crab. The fishing should just get batter hopefully the weather stays like it was today and we’ll be able to get across the straight and to fish off the South end of Bowen Island. March 29th 2010

Well the weather this weekend was not on our side. Not many people went out. The algae bloom seems to have arrived in parts of Howe Sound already. The salmon fishing seemed to have slowed down abit on thursday and friday last week at Grace, 3rd marker, and Tunstal but the water was very brown with the algae bloom. There was a boat that got out for awhile on sunday and fished Tunstal bay for a few hours. He did end up with one legal Spring and 2 undersize not bad for a few hours. The south end of Bowen island should start to pick up here in the next week or two. There is the odd Spring getting caught on the flood at the Capilano river off the marker. There will be alot more activity on the water if the weather gets back to being nice including myself just waiting for calm winds and flat water. Crabbing and prawning remain very good and should continue untill the commercial prawn fishery is opened. Good luck till then give me a call if you need any questions answered.

Fishing Report March 23 2010

The fishing has picked up on the west side of Bowen in the last few days. The Spring salmon fishing in Howe Sound on the west side of Bowen island has picked up at Grace Islands, Hutt Island, and 3rd Marker. The weather has been on our side and some nice Springs in the 8 to 16 pound range have been caught there also have been quite a few undersize fish caught also that range in size from 5lbs to just undersize. It should just keep getting better as the Spring moves on and we’ll start fishing off the South end of Bowen Island to the Gulf Islands soon. Crabbing and Prawning remains great. Fishing Report July 16th

Fishing has been picking up the last few days. With the water being calm the last few days people have gotten over to the Gulf Islands. Thrasher Rock and the Grande have produced. Some boats have done very well limiting out on Spring salmon up to 30lbs most fish seem to be in the high teens. This fishery is great you drag the bottom so you’re usually busy with some kind off bottom fish if you don’t have a Spring on. On this side off the Straight of Georgia, Howe Sound some nice Springs have been taken off Hole in the Wall, Grace, and Salmon Rock. In English Bay the Bell Buoy has quite a few undersize Springs with the odd big one. The West van shoreline seems to still be active when you get on top off a school of Coho with a Spring mixed in. I got my first Sockeye of the year yesterday off the sailing club off 14th street that was a surprise hitting a spoon we also lost a Coho, had a couple other hits, a few small salmon, and a few cod when we were dragging the bottom off the pink apartment. There seems to be quite alot of small salmon (grilse) on there way out to see a good sign for years to come.
